#!/usr/bin/env python3
from datetime import datetime
from phabricator import Phabricator
import numpy as np
import matplotlib.pyplot as plt
import matplotlib.cm as cm
import matplotlib.dates as mdates
from scipy.ndimage.filters import gaussian_filter

start = datetime(year=2020, month=7, day=1)


def format_stamp(stamp):
    dt = datetime.utcfromtimestamp(stamp)
    date = mdates.date2num(dt)
    time = dt.hour + dt.minute / 60.0
    return [date, time]


phab = Phabricator()  # This will use your ~/.arcrc file
diff = phab.differential.query()

dates = []
for d in diff:
    created = format_stamp(int(d["dateCreated"]))
    modified = format_stamp(int(d["dateModified"]))
    dates += [created, modified]



def myplot(x, y, s, bins=1000):
    heatmap, xedges, yedges = np.histogram2d(x, y, bins=bins)
    heatmap = gaussian_filter(heatmap, sigma=s)

    extent = [xedges[0], xedges[-1], yedges[0], yedges[-1]]
    return heatmap.T, extent


fig, axs = plt.subplots(2, 2)


sigmas = [0, 16, 32, 48]
x = [i for i, j in dates]
y = [j for i, j in dates]
daymonthFmt = mdates.DateFormatter('%d %B')

for ax, s in zip(axs.flatten(), sigmas):
    ax.xaxis.set_major_formatter(daymonthFmt)
    _ = plt.xticks(rotation=90)
    if s == 0:
        ax.plot(x, y, 'k.', markersize=5)
        ax.set_title("Scatter plot")
    else:
        img, extent = myplot(x, y, s)
        ax.imshow(img, extent=extent, origin='lower', cmap=cm.jet)
        ax.set_title("Smoothing with  $\sigma$ = %d" % s)

plt.show()
